Transaction 4c31c48c44665a4b57096019f2b877d377b1e3e317f9260168161c3866871490

3 Input
2 Outputs
  • 4c31c48c44665a4b57096019f2b877d377b1e3e317f9260168161c3866871490:0
  • value  1000759
    address  324TD9XTWzUaAaJQhRvURZKtfgBGMYUHgD
  • 4c31c48c44665a4b57096019f2b877d377b1e3e317f9260168161c3866871490:1
  • value  500000
    address  1NDMEARPWx5cVMyjqcmeLk97zCLM4FJZZ3